Should be able to find a decent port 2g exhaust manifold for cheap on various DSM forums.

Plastic screw on TB is your BISS screw, it fine tunes the idle. Replace it otherwise you'll start to idle surge eventually if you already aren't.

Stock FPR should keep you in good hands for a while, when you start hitting low 12s you might consider an aftermarket setup. Stock fuel rail flows surprisingly well.
